The Evolution of Dashboard Design: Best Practices for Data Visualization in Decision Support Systems

Abstract

The evolution of dashboard design has been driven by the increasing demand for effective decision support systems (DSS) across industries. Modern dashboards serve as powerful tools for data visualization, enabling organizations to analyze complex datasets, identify trends, and make informed decisions. Over the years, dashboard design has transitioned from static reports to interactive, real-time data representations, incorporating advanced visual analytics, artificial intelligence, and user-centered design principles. The primary goal of dashboard design is to enhance usability, improve cognitive load management, and ensure clarity in data interpretation. Best practices in dashboard design focus on several key principles: simplicity, relevance, consistency, and interactivity. Effective dashboards prioritize critical metrics through intuitive layouts, minimizing cognitive overload by eliminating unnecessary elements. The use of data visualization techniques such as charts, graphs, and heatmaps enhances pattern recognition and trend analysis. Additionally, color psychology and design heuristics play a crucial role in ensuring that dashboards are not only visually appealing but also functionally efficient. Furthermore, dashboards in modern decision support systems leverage automation and AI-driven analytics to provide predictive insights, real-time alerts, and data storytelling features. Despite significant advancements, dashboard design presents challenges, including information overload, poor data integration, and lack of standardization. Ensuring accessibility and user adaptability remains crucial, as different users may require customized views tailored to their specific roles and expertise levels. The integration of responsive design, mobile compatibility, and cloud-based data streaming further enhances dashboard effectiveness in dynamic decision-making environments. As dashboard technologies continue to evolve, emerging trends such as augmented analytics, natural language processing, and voice-activated interactions are transforming the landscape of data visualization. Future advancements will emphasize more intelligent, context-aware dashboards that anticipate user needs and facilitate proactive decision-making. Organizations must adopt best practices in dashboard design to optimize data-driven strategies, improve business intelligence, and enhance overall efficiency in decision support systems.
